Thesis Abstract

This research project aims to investigate the intricate relationship between language and social hierarchies, exploring how language use and linguistic features contribute to the construction and perpetuation of social inequalities. The study will examine the role of language in reflecting and reinforcing social hierarchies, analyzing linguistic markers of power, prestige, and identity. By delving into the sociolinguistic dimensions of social hierarchies, the research seeks to provide insights into the ways in which language shapes and reflects social structures.
